How Wegovy Works

You eat less on Wegovy because it mimics the action of a hormone known as GLP-1 that is involved in appetite and how long food stays undigested in your stomach. The dual action of Wegovy generally suppresses appetite and cravings, and it makes you feel fuller longer, so eating less while on Wegovy is relatively easy to do.

The time it takes for Wegovy to start working will vary among patients. However, most people start to experience a decrease in appetite within the first few days to weeks of starting the medication.

Top Foods to Avoid on Wegovy

The Wegovy “Don’t” List Includes:

  • Fatty Meats – Fatty meats, like any high-fat food, should be avoided while taking Wegovy. High-fat foods are harder to digest, which can make Wegovy side effects like diarrhea, gas, and nausea worse. Fatty meats are also high in calories, so they can put you over the amount of calories you should eat each day.
  • Whole Dairy – Whole dairy, like whole milk, whole milk yoghurts, ice cream, and full-fat cheeses, just like fatty meats, should be avoided on Wegovy for their fat content, high calories, and digestive issues.
  • Alcohol – Alcohol should not be part of any healthy diet. It’s high in sugar and carbs and is basically empty calories. Drinking booze also encourages you to eat salty, fatty snacks like chips, and drinking can also cause you to make other bad food choices while “under the influence.”
  • Sugary Drinks– Sugary drinks like sodas and juices with high-fructose corn syrup are a “no-no” in any healthy diet, but they should be particularly avoided while on Wegovy. These drinks are filled with sugar and a lot of calories with no nutritional value.
  • Sweets and Pastries – Like sugary drinks, you should avoid “sweet treats” like cake, cookies, and pastries on Wegovy. These are all high in sugar and can cause “spikes” in your blood sugar levels, which can counteract the positive impact that Wegovy has on insulin resistance and glucose metabolism. Plus, these are also high in calories and often high in fat as well.
  • Salty Foods– Many people on Wegovy also have issues with high blood pressure. Foods with a high salt content can contribute to hypertension. Salty foods also contribute to systemic inflammation and can lead to heart disease, both of which can interfere with your ability to lose weight on Wegovy.

While there is not an “official” amount of calories you should restrict yourself to while on Wegovy, participants in the second set of Wegovy clinical trials (STEP 3) did best when they kept to between 1000 and 1200 calories per day.

Our weight loss team suggests a minimum of 60 grams (about 2 ounces) of protein per day, preferably spread out over meals and snacks. Protein is essential to help you build muscle mass, which further boosts your metabolism and will enhance the fat-burning effects of Wegovy.

How to Maintain a Healthy Diet While on Wegovy

Now that you know how important it is to eat a healthy diet while on Wegovy, how about a little more help on how to do it.

  • Practice good hydration habits: Stay hydrated by drinking plenty of water throughout the day. The recommended fluid intake is at least 72 oz for women and 100 oz for men.
  • Consume regular meals and snacks: Eating regular meals and healthy snacks can help maintain stable blood sugar levels and enhance the appetite-suppressant effects of Wegovy. Never skip meals; that will only lead to increased hunger and making poor “quick fix” food choices.
  • Engage in mindful eating: Practice mindful eating by listening to your body’s hunger and fullness cues. Eat slowly, savor your food, and avoid distractions like TV or smartphones during meals. A 2012 Dutch study found that obese patients who were taught mindful eating techniques lost significantly more weight than those who were not trained in the practice.
  • Do not expect overnight results: Even with a proper diet and an effective obesity drug like Wegovy, weight management takes time and consistent effort. Be patient with yourself and stay committed to healthy eating and other lifestyle changes.
  • Do not give up all the foods you love: Our weight loss professionals realize that making food you love completely “off-limits” can only make you crave it more and can add to stress overeating for Overall success. It’s important to give yourself permission to eat for pleasure – in moderation, and not completely deprive yourself of all the foods you enjoy!
